    HB1711 was passed 94 yea, 14 nay, 8 present to be advanced. It basically says that politicians cannot carry a firearm without a CCW permit. :D Step in the right direction.

    Politicians were becoming "conservators of the peace" by becoming sworn officers without the training and actually becoming an officer so they could carry firearms.

    In Illinois it is not "D" V "R" it is basicly Chicago against the rest of the state. Rep. Phelps who introduced HB997 is a southern Ill. democrat. There was only one representive south of I-80 that voted against the last good carry bill. That is a Madigan stooge from Urbana. Jim.
